I have to share something funny that happened today with everyone. I am a painter--I paint houses. My past life as a smoker included taking smoke breaks throughout the day. The first couple of weeks when quitting really, really sucked. I couldn't quit thinking about smoking. But, thank God is has been much better this week. I go really long periods of time without even giving it a thought! Yeal!!! I'm on day 25. But, today when I got in my truck to come home the weirdest thing happened. My brain said--and I quote--"phone--check, sunglasses--check, water--check, purse/bag--check, cigarettes--?????!!!!! WTF????????!!@@#%%)(*^%". It was just a split second of a thought, but it made me laught out loud!!! That's when I decided Yoda would say "Pretty sneaky addiction--that nicotine is! Well, wanted to share a laugh & a smile with all of you. Hey, we have to have a sense of humor about this stupid addiction. Hope you all had a great day. And if not, maybe I have provided some entertainment value for you. Love you all--Thank you for all of the support. I couldn't wait to get home to tell all of you how funny this quit can be if we will just allow ourselves to relax and enjoy the ride!
